Downloading files using the Firefox browser seems like a pretty straightforward process. You click a link, perhaps choose where to save the file, and wait for the file transfer to complete. However, you have more control over this process than you probably realize, as the browser offers the ability to customize various download-related settings in Firefox: changing the download location, displaying plugins, and more.

You can make these changes behind the scenes via Firefox's about:config preferences. Below, we'll show you how.

First, open Firefox and type the following text into the browser’s address bar: about:config. Then press Enter. You should now see a warning message stating that this may void your warranty. If so, press I’ll be careful, I promise!

A list of Firefox preferences should now appear in the current tab. In the search field provided, enter the following text: browser.download. All download-related choices should be visible.
